TSJA 150KVA Three Phase Oil Immersed Induction Voltage Stabilizer/Regulator
1 TSJA-150/ specification parameters of induction voltage regulator
1.1 Product model: TSJA-150/0.44
1.2 rated capacity: 150kVA.
1.3 Number of phases: 3
1.4 Frequency: 50Hz
1.5 rated input voltage: 440V.
1.6 rated output voltage: 0-440V adjustable.
1.7 rated output current: 196A.
1.8 insulation grade: class a.
1.9 cooling mode: strong oil circulation
1.10 voltage regulation mode: electric, supplemented by manual.
1.11 Working mode: Long-term operation
1.12 Use environment: indoors
1.13 Weight: 1200kg
1.14 inches: 120*166CM

Technical requirements
2.1 The output voltage should be stepless, smooth and continuously adjustable.
2.2 Output voltage waveform distortion rate When the input voltage of the voltage regulator is rated and the waveform distortion rate is not more than 2%, the no-load output voltage of the voltage regulator is within the output voltage range of more than 25%, and the waveform distortion rate should be not more than 5%.
2.3 Asymmetry of Output Voltage When the three-phase input voltage of the voltage regulator is symmetrical and rated, the asymmetry of the maximum three-phase no-load output voltage should not be greater than 1%.

2.5 Temperature rise: oil level temperature rises by 55K, and winding temperature rises by 65K. (Resistance measurement)
2.6 The servo motor adopts 3-phase AC asynchronous motor.
2.7 The product is equipped with a dehumidifier and a temperature indicating controller.
2.8 Limit switches with upper and lower limit positions (normally open and normally closed).
2.9 25# transformer oil is used as the cooling oil for the voltage regulator.
2.10 The iron core of voltage regulator adopts B50A470 non-oriented cold-rolled silicon steel sheet produced by Baosteel Company, the electromagnetic wire adopts self-adhesive double glass filament wrapped with polyester film and a layer of epoxy impregnated copper flat wire, and the coil insulation material is polypropylene film composite tape.
2.11 In addition to the above technical requirements, the other technical requirements are in accordance with People's Republic of China (PRC) machinery industry standard JB/T 8749.1 "Regulator Part 1: General Requirements and Tests" and JB/T 8749.2-2013 "Induction Regulator".
